Abstract

Left ventricular enlargement (LVE) typically indicates a common occurrence in cardiac remodeling, closely associated with heart failure (HF). Pulse waves, serving as messengers of the cardiovascular system, have been confirmed to reflect cardiac conditions. In this study we developed a machine learning (ML) methodology to predict LVE in patients with HF based on pulse wave signals from 264 HF patients. The proposed ML methods have been verified as capable of achieving effective classification and regression with excellent performance, thereby revealing the feasibility and potential of identifying LVE patients based on pulse wave signals.
